83d988933d8507ccf6f9f76b3b0fc209.json 3.5 KB

1
  1. {"remainingRequest":"D:\\cloud\\cemp\\cemp-ui\\node_modules\\vue-loader\\lib\\index.js??vue-loader-options!D:\\cloud\\cemp\\cemp-ui\\src\\views\\admin\\role\\index.vue?vue&type=template&id=4c33675a&scoped=true&","dependencies":[{"path":"D:\\cloud\\cemp\\cemp-ui\\src\\views\\admin\\role\\index.vue","mtime":1619070292889},{"path":"D:\\cloud\\cemp\\cemp-ui\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\cloud\\cemp\\cemp-ui\\node_modules\\vue-loader\\lib\\loaders\\templateLoader.js","mtime":499162500000},{"path":"D:\\cloud\\cemp\\cemp-ui\\node_modules\\cache-loader\\dist\\cjs.js","mtime":499162500000},{"path":"D:\\cloud\\cemp\\cemp-ui\\node_modules\\vue-loader\\lib\\index.js","mtime":499162500000}],"contextDependencies":[],"result":["\n<div class=\"app-container calendar-list-container\">\n <basic-container>\n <avue-crud\n ref=\"crud\"\n :option=\"tableOption\"\n :data=\"list\"\n :page.sync=\"page\"\n v-model=\"form\"\n :table-loading=\"listLoading\"\n :before-open=\"handleOpenBefore\"\n @on-load=\"getList\"\n @search-change=\"handleFilter\"\n @refresh-change=\"handleRefreshChange\"\n @row-update=\"update\"\n @row-save=\"create\">\n\n <template slot=\"menuLeft\">\n <el-button\n v-if=\"roleManager_btn_add\"\n class=\"filter-item\"\n type=\"primary\"\n icon=\"el-icon-edit\"\n @click=\"$refs.crud.rowAdd()\">添加\n </el-button>\n </template>\n <template slot=\"dsScopeForm\" slot-scope=\"scope\">\n <div v-if=\"form.dsType == 1\">\n <el-tree\n ref=\"scopeTree\"\n :data=\"dsScopeData\"\n :check-strictly=\"true\"\n :props=\"defaultProps\"\n :default-checked-keys=\"checkedDsScope\"\n class=\"filter-tree\"\n node-key=\"id\"\n highlight-current\n show-checkbox/>\n </div>\n </template>\n\n <template\n slot=\"menu\"\n slot-scope=\"scope\">\n <el-button\n v-if=\"roleManager_btn_edit\"\n type=\"text\"\n icon=\"el-icon-edit\"\n @click=\"handleUpdate(scope.row,scope.index)\">编辑\n </el-button>\n <el-button\n v-if=\"roleManager_btn_del\"\n type=\"text\"\n icon=\"el-icon-delete\"\n @click=\"handleDelete(scope.row,scope.index)\">删除\n </el-button>\n <el-button\n v-if=\"roleManager_btn_perm\"\n type=\"text\"\n icon=\"el-icon-plus\"\n @click=\"handlePermission(scope.row,scope.index)\">权限\n </el-button>\n </template>\n </avue-crud>\n </basic-container>\n <el-dialog\n :visible.sync=\"dialogPermissionVisible\"\n :close-on-click-modal=\"false\"\n title=\"分配权限\">\n <div class=\"dialog-main-tree\">\n <el-tree\n ref=\"menuTree\"\n :data=\"treeData\"\n :default-checked-keys=\"checkedKeys\"\n :check-strictly=\"false\"\n :props=\"defaultProps\"\n :filter-node-method=\"filterNode\"\n class=\"filter-tree\"\n node-key=\"id\"\n highlight-current\n show-checkbox\n default-expand-all/>\n </div>\n <div slot=\"footer\"\n class=\"dialog-footer\">\n <el-button\n type=\"primary\"\n @click=\"updatePermession(roleId)\">更 新\n </el-button>\n <el-button\n type=\"default\"\n @click=\"cancal()\">取消\n </el-button>\n </div>\n </el-dialog>\n</div>\n",null]}